💻 Word にマクロを远加する方法【VBA で自動化】

f09f92bb word e381abe3839ee382afe383ade38292e8bfbde58aa0e38199e3828be696b9e6b395e38090vba e381a7e887aae58b95e58c96e38091
5/5 - (209 votes)

Wordにマを远加するこずで、繰り返しの䜜業を自動化し、効率的に䜜業を行うこずができたす。この蚘事では、VBAVisual Basic for Applicationsを䜿甚しおWordにマを远加する方法を詳しく解説したす。マの蚘録方法から、VBA゚ディタでのコヌド線集、そしお䜜成したマの実行方法たで、ステップバむステップで説明したす。たた、マを䜿甚する䞊で泚意すべき点や、䟿利なサンプルコヌドも玹介したすので、初心者の方でも安心しお取り組むこずができたす。Wordの機胜を最倧限に掻甚し、䜜業効率を向䞊させるために、この蚘事を参考にしおみおください。

Table

マクロを自動実行するにはどうしたらいいですか

image 17

マを自動実行するには、Visual Basic for ApplicationsVBAの機胜を䜿甚したす。具䜓的には、むベント ハンドラヌを蚭定する必芁がありたす。むベント ハンドラヌずは、特定のむベントが発生したずきに自動的に実行されるマのこずです。

むベント ハンドラヌの蚭定方法

むベント ハンドラヌを蚭定するには、以䞋の手順に埓いたす。

  1. Visual Basic Editorを開きたす。Visual Basic Editorは、Excelのメニュヌから「開発」→「Visual Basic」たたは「Alt + F11」キヌで開くこずができたす。
  2. モゞュヌルを䜜成したす。モゞュヌルは、VBAのコヌドを蚘述する堎所です。モゞュヌルを䜜成するには、Visual Basic Editorの「挿入」メニュヌから「モゞュヌル」を遞択したす。
  3. むベント ハンドラヌを蚘述したす。むベント ハンドラヌを蚘述するには、モゞュヌルに以䞋のようなコヌドを蚘述したす。
    vb
    Private Sub Workbook_Open() ' マを実行するコヌドを蚘述したす。
    End Sub

マの実行条件の蚭定

マの実行条件を蚭定するには、以䞋の手順に埓いたす。

  1. 条件を蚭定したす。条件を蚭定するには、むベント ハンドラヌのコヌド内に以䞋のようなコヌドを蚘述したす。
    vb
    If 条件 Then ' マを実行するコヌドを蚘述したす。
    End If
  2. 条件の皮類を遞択したす。条件の皮類には、倀の比范や匏の評䟡などがありたす。条件の皮類を遞択するには、条件のコヌド内に以䞋のようなコヌドを蚘述したす。
    vb
    If Range(A1).Value = 条件倀 Then ' マを実行するコヌドを蚘述したす。
    End If
  3. 条件の組み合わせを蚭定したす。条件の組み合わせを蚭定するには、条件のコヌド内に以䞋のようなコヌドを蚘述したす。
    vb
    If Range(A1).Value = 条件倀 And Range(B1).Value = 条件倀 Then ' マを実行するコヌドを蚘述したす。
    End If

マの実行゚ラヌのハンドリング

マの実行゚ラヌのハンドリングを蚭定するには、以䞋の手順に埓いたす。

  1. ゚ラヌ ハンドラヌを蚭定したす。゚ラヌ ハンドラヌを蚭定するには、むベント ハンドラヌのコヌド内に以䞋のようなコヌドを蚘述したす。
    vb
    On Error GoTo ゚ラヌ凊理
  2. ゚ラヌ凊理を蚘述したす。゚ラヌ凊理を蚘述するには、゚ラヌ ハンドラヌのコヌド内に以䞋のようなコヌドを蚘述したす。
    vb
    ゚ラヌ凊理: ' ゚ラヌを凊理するコヌドを蚘述したす。
  3. ゚ラヌの皮類を遞択したす。゚ラヌの皮類には、実行時゚ラヌやシンタックス ゚ラヌなどがありたす。゚ラヌの皮類を遞択するには、゚ラヌ ハンドラヌのコヌド内に以䞋のようなコヌドを蚘述したす。
    vb
    On Error GoTo ゚ラヌ凊理 ' 実行時゚ラヌを凊理するコヌドを蚘述したす。

Excel2010でVBAを起動するにはどうすればいいですか

macro75

Excel 2010 で VBA を起動するには、以䞋の手順を実行したす。 開発タブを衚瀺するには、ファむルメニュヌの「オプション」をクリックし、「リボンをカスタマむズする」を遞択したす。次に、「開発」チェックボックスをオンにしお、「OK」をクリックしたす。 ここで、開発タブが衚瀺されたす。このタブの「Visual Basic」をクリックするず、VBA ゚ディタヌが起動したす。

開発タブを衚瀺する方法

開発タブを衚瀺するには、以䞋の手順を実行したす。

  1. ファむルメニュヌの「オプション」をクリックしたす。
  2. 「リボンをカスタマむズする」を遞択したす。
  3. 「開発」チェックボックスをオンにしお、「OK」をクリックしたす。

VBA ゚ディタヌを起動する方法

VBA ゚ディタヌを起動するには、以䞋の手順を実行したす。

  1. 開発タブの「Visual Basic」をクリックしたす。
  2. VBA プロゞェクト゚クスプロヌラヌが衚瀺されたす。
  3. モゞュヌルやフォヌムを远加しお、VBA コヌドを蚘述できたす。

VBA のセキュリティ蚭定を倉曎する方法

VBA のセキュリティ蚭定を倉曎するには、以䞋の手順を実行したす。

  1. ファむルメニュヌの「オプション」をクリックしたす。
  2. 「セキュリティセンタヌ」を遞択したす。
  3. 「マの蚭定」をクリックし、セキュリティレベルを倉曎したす。

Wordにマを远加する方法【VBAで自動化】

マを䜿甚するず、Microsoft Wordで繰り返し行う䜜業を自動化できたす。VBAVisual Basic for Applicationsを䜿甚しお独自のマを䜜成し、䜜業を効率化するこずができたす。ここでは、Wordにマを远加する方法を詳しく説明したす。

マの蚘録方法

Wordでは、マの蚘録を開始しお、操䜜を実行し、蚘録を停止するこずで、マを䜜成できたす。

  1. 開発タブから「マの蚘録」をクリックしたす。
  2. マの名前を付け、保存先を遞択しお「OK」をクリックしたす。
  3. 蚘録を開始し、自動化したい操䜜を行いたす。
  4. 操䜜が終わったら、「マの蚘録終了」をクリックしたす。

VBA゚ディタヌでマを線集する方法

蚘録したマをVBA゚ディタヌで線集し、より耇雑な凊理を远加できたす。

  1. 開発タブから「VBA゚ディタヌ」を開きたす。
  2. NormalプロゞェクトのModulesフォルダにあるマを探しおダブルクリックしたす。
  3. VBAコヌドを線集し、倉曎を保存したす。

マの実行方法

䜜成したマは、以䞋の方法で実行できたす。

  1. 開発タブから「マ」をクリックしたす。
  2. 実行したいマを遞択しお「実行」をクリックしたす。

マの割り圓お方法

マをリボンやショヌトカットキヌに割り圓おるこずで、より手軜に実行できるようになりたす。

  1. オプションの「リボンのカスタマむズ」からマを遞択し、リボンに远加したす。
  2. ショヌトカットキヌの割り圓おを行うには、「キヌボヌドのカスタマむズ」からマを遞択し、キヌを割り圓おたす。

マのセキュリティ蚭定

マは匷力な機胜ですが、悪意のあるコヌドが実行されるリスクもありたす。Wordのマセキュリティ蚭定を適切に蚭定しおおくこずが重芁です。

  1. セキュリティセンタヌの「マの蚭定」から、適切なセキュリティレベルを遞択したす。
  2. 信頌できるマのみを実行するように蚭定したす。
項目 説明
マの蚘録 操䜜を蚘録し、マを䜜成したす。
VBA゚ディタヌ マのコヌドを線集し、耇雑な凊理を远加したす。
マの実行 䜜成したマを実行したす。
マの割り圓お リボンやショヌトカットキヌにマを割り圓おたす。
マのセキュリティ蚭定 マのセキュリティレベルを蚭定し、安党に䜿甚したす。

VBAでマクロを自動実行するにはどうしたらいいですか

image 17

VBAでマを自動実行する方法は以䞋の通りです。

ワヌクシヌトむベントを䜿甚する

ワヌクシヌトむベントを利甚しお、特定のむベントが発生したずきにマを自動実行するこずができたす。たずえば、セルに倀が入力されたずきや、ワヌクシヌトがアクティブになったずきなどにマを実行できたす。

  1. コヌドを远加するワヌクシヌトを右クリックし、コヌドの衚瀺を遞択したす。
  2. コヌドりィンドりに、むベント名ずマ名を入力したす。䟋: Private Sub Worksheet_Change(ByVal Target As Range)
  3. マの凊理内容を蚘述したす。

タむマヌを䜿甚する

Application.OnTimeメ゜ッドを䜿甚しお、指定した時間にマを自動実行するこずができたす。䞀定間隔で繰り返し実行させるこずも可胜です。

  1. マの最初に、次回の実行時刻を指定しおApplication.OnTimeを呌び出したす。䟋: Application.OnTime Now + TimeValue(00:01:00), マ名
  2. マの凊理内容を蚘述したす。
  3. マの最埌に、次回の実行をスケゞュヌルしたす。

ワヌクブックの開閉時に実行する

ワヌクブックのむベントを利甚しお、ワヌクブックを開いたずきや閉じるずきにマを自動実行できたす。

  1. ワヌクブック党䜓に適甚するため、ThisWorkbookコヌドりィンドりを開きたす。
  2. むベント名ずマ名を入力したす。䟋: Private Sub Workbook_Open() たたは Private Sub Workbook_BeforeClose(Cancel As Boolean)
  3. マの凊理内容を蚘述したす。

Wordのマクロの远加方法は

wdUset2003 01

Wordでマを远加する方法は以䞋の通りです。

マの録画

Wordでは、操䜜を蚘録しおマを䜜成するこずができたす。これは、マの「録画」ず呌ばれたす。

  1. たず、「衚瀺」タブにある「マ」をクリックしたす。
  2. 次に、「マの録画」を遞択したす。
  3. マの名前を付け、「OK」をクリックしお録画を開始したす。
  4. 行いたい操䜜を行いたす。これらの操䜜が蚘録されたす。
  5. 操䜜が終わったら、再床「マ」をクリックし、「録画の停止」を遞択したす。

マの実行

録画したマは、以䞋の手順で実行できたす。

  1. 「衚瀺」タブの「マ」をクリックしたす。
  2. 「マの衚瀺」を遞択したす。
  3. 実行したいマを遞択し、「実行」をクリックしたす。

マの線集

マを線集するには、以䞋の手順に埓いたす。

  1. 「衚瀺」タブの「マ」をクリックしたす。
  2. 「マの衚瀺」を遞択したす。
  3. 線集したいマを遞択し、「線集」をクリックしたす。
  4. Visual Basic Editorが開かれるので、ここでマのコヌドを線集できたす。

Wordでマクロを実行するにはどうすればいいですか

a6750376 f7a3 4d80 951b f4ec32309357

Wordでマを実行するには、以䞋の手順に埓っおください。

マの有効化

Wordでマを実行する前に、マが有効になっおいるこずを確認しおください。マを有効にするには、以䞋の手順を実行したす。

  1. Wordを開き、[ファむル]メニュヌを開きたす。
  2. [オプション]をクリックしたす。
  3. [セキュリティセンタヌ]をクリックし、[セキュリティセンタヌの蚭定]ボタンをクリックしたす。
  4. [マの蚭定]セクションで、[すべおのマを有効にする]を遞択したす。

マの実行

マを実行するには、以䞋の手順を実行したす。

  1. [衚瀺]メニュヌを開き、[マ]をクリックしたす。
  2. 実行するマを遞択し、[実行]ボタンをクリックしたす。

マの割り圓お

マをキヌボヌドショヌトカットやリボンに割り圓おるこずで、より効率的にマを実行できたす。

  1. [ファむル]メニュヌを開き、[オプション]をクリックしたす。
  2. [カスタマむズ]をクリックし、[キヌボヌドショヌトカットのカスタマむズ]ボタンをクリックしたす。
  3. [カテゎリ]で[マ]を遞択し、割り圓おるマを遞択したす。
  4. [新しいショヌトカットキヌ]ボックスにショヌトカットキヌを入力し、[割り圓お]ボタンをクリックしたす。

マクロファむルを自動で開くには

tec1 39

マファむルを自動で開く方法には以䞋のようなものがありたす。

マを自動実行する方法

マファむルを自動で開くためには、たずマを自動実行する蚭定を行う必芁がありたす。これは、Excelのオプション蚭定から行うこずができたす。

  1. Excelを開き、ファむルメニュヌからオプションをクリックしたす。
  2. セキュリティセンタヌをクリックし、セキュリティセンタヌの蚭定ボタンをクリックしたす。
  3. マの蚭定で、すべおのマを有効にするを遞択したす。

ワヌクシヌトが開かれたずきにマを実行する

ワヌクシヌトが開かれたずきにマを自動的に実行するためには、Workbook_Openむベントを䜿甚したす。これは、VBA゚ディタで以䞋の手順を行いたす。

  1. 目的のワヌクブックを開き、 開発タブからVBA゚ディタを開きたす。
  2. ThisWorkbookモゞュヌルを開き、Workbook_Openむベントを远加したす。
  3. 自動実行したいマの名前をWorkbook_Openむベント内に蚘述したす。

ショヌトカットキヌを䜿甚しおマを実行する

マにショヌトカットキヌを割り圓おるず、マを速やかに実行するこずができたす。この蚭定は、以䞋の手順で行いたす。

  1. マを蚘録たたは䜜成し、マの衚瀺から目的のマを遞択したす。
  2. オプションボタンをクリックし、ショヌトカットキヌフィヌルドに任意のキヌを入力したす。
  3. OKボタンをクリックしお蚭定を確定したす。

よくある質問

Wordにマを远加するにはどうすればいいですか

Wordにマを远加するには、Visual Basic for ApplicationsVBAを䜿甚したす。たず、Wordで「開発」タブを開き、「マの蚘録」ボタンをクリックしお、任意の名前でマを新芏䜜成したす。その埌、マのコヌドを線集するために「VBA゚ディタ」を開き、必芁な凊理を蚘述したす。䟋えば、文曞内で特定の単語を自動的に眮換するマを曞くこずができたす。マの蚘録を終了したら、「マの実行」ボタンで䜜成したマを実行できたす。

VBA゚ディタでWordのマを線集するにはどうすればいいですか

VBA゚ディタでWordのマを線集するには、たず Word で「開発」タブを開き、「VBA゚ディタ」ボタンをクリックしたす。VBA゚ディタが開いたら、プロゞェクト゚クスプロヌラで線集したいマが含たれる文曞を遞択し、コヌドりィンドりでマのコヌドを線集したす。䟋えば、新しい文曞を䜜成しお自動的に特定のテキストを挿入するマを線集する堎合、Selection.TypeTextメ゜ッドを䜿甚しおテキストを挿入できたす。線集が終わったら、VBA゚ディタを閉じおWordでマを実行したす。

Wordのマで文曞の自動化凊理を行うにはどのようなVBAコヌドを曞けばいいですか

Wordのマで文曞の自動化凊理を行うには、VBAで以䞋のようなコヌドを曞きたす。たずえば、文曞内の特定の単語を別の単語に眮換するマを曞く堎合、WithステヌトメントでSelection.Findオブゞェクトを䜿甚しお、眮換前の単語を怜玢し、Replacement.Textプロパティで眮換埌の単語を指定したす。そしお、Replaceメ゜ッドを呌び出しお眮換を実行したす。たた、ルヌプ凊理を䜿甚しお、文曞党䜓で眮換を繰り返すこずができたす。

Wordのマでナヌザヌフォヌムを䜜成するにはどうすればいいですか

Wordのマでナヌザヌフォヌムを䜜成するには、VBA゚ディタで挿入メニュヌからナヌザヌフォヌムを遞択したす。その埌、ツヌルボックスからフォヌムに必芁なコントロヌルボタン、テキストボックス、ラベルなどをドラッグドロップで远加し、それぞれの蚭定を行いたす。たた、コヌドりィンドりで各コントロヌルのむベント凊理を蚘述したす。䟋えば、ボタンのClickむベントに、フォヌムの入力倀を元に文曞の内容を倉曎する凊理を蚘述できたす。ナヌザヌフォヌムを䜿甚するこずで、Wordのマをよりむンタラクティブにできたす。

💻 Word にマクロを远加する方法【VBA で自動化】 に類䌌した他の蚘事を知りたい堎合は、Word 基本操䜜 カテゎリにアクセスしおください。

関連蚘事

コメントを残す

メヌルアドレスが公開されるこずはありたせん。 ※ が付いおいる欄は必須項目です

Your score: Useful